A cylinder has a base radius of 6 feet and a height of 12 feet.What is it's volume in cubic feet, to the nearest tenths place

Mathematics
1 answer:
Neporo4naja [7]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

volume = \pi {r}^{2} h \\ =  3.14 \times  {6}^{2}  \times 12 \\  = 1357.2 \:  {ft}^{3}
